Vitalik publica un nuevo artículo "Memory access is O(N^[1/3])": analiza la complejidad del acceso a la memoria y la eficiencia de los sistemas blockchain
El 5 de octubre, Vitalik publicó un nuevo artículo titulado “Memory access is O(N^(1/3))”, en el que explora la complejidad del acceso a la memoria y discute el problema de la complejidad del “acceso a memoria” en estructuras de datos y algoritmos. Propone que, bajo ciertas arquitecturas o modelos, el costo de acceder a la memoria podría tener un límite superior de O(N^(1/3)). Señala que la complejidad temporal de los algoritmos clásicos de ordenamiento es O(N log N), pero que, al considerar los cuellos de botella en el acceso a la memoria, es necesario reevaluar el análisis de eficiencia para conjuntos de datos a gran escala. Este tema resulta inspirador para el diseño de sistemas subyacentes de blockchain, especialmente al tratar con estados a gran escala, sincronización de nodos y mecanismos de disponibilidad de datos (DA / muestreo de disponibilidad de datos, etc.), donde es aún más importante considerar cuidadosamente los cuellos de botella en la eficiencia de “lectura y escritura de memoria”.
Descargo de responsabilidad: El contenido de este artículo refleja únicamente la opinión del autor y no representa en modo alguno a la plataforma. Este artículo no se pretende servir de referencia para tomar decisiones de inversión.

